March 03, 2008 (Routine)
Violation: 3180 - The floor under the prep coolers noted in need of cleaning. All floors, walls, and ceilings must be cleaned as often as necessary to keep them clean. Cleaning of the physical facilities is an important measure in ensuring the protection and sanitary preparation of food. A regular cleaning schedule should be established and followed to maintain the facility in a clean and sanitary manner.
Comments:
Correct today. The big 4 reportable illnesses along with signs and symptoms was reviewed today. Handouts covering illness symptoms that need to be reported to management was left with manager. Food temperature were good. The quat sanitizer at 3-vat sink was 200 ppm.
September 17, 2007 (Complaint)
Comments:
The purpose of this visit was due to a complaint of an ill worker. Spoke to managment who was unaware of the complaint. Verified employee is not working at this time and is not scheduled to work untill Sept 22. Manager stated that employee will not work until they have a doctor's note showing they are well and cleared to work with food. Discussed signs and symptoms of illness and when to exclude employee.
